As one of the first areas settled in Indianapolis, the historic Holy Cross neighborhood dates back to roughly 1819. Holy Cross is located directly east of downtown, with I-70 along the west side. The center of the neighborhood is Highland Park, the highest point in the city. The park dates back to 1898 and offers fantastic views of the downtown skyline. Because of its elevation, the park is a popular gathering spot for the 4th of July fireworks.
The neighborhood is named for the Holy Cross Catholic Church and School, which sits on the neighborhood's east side. Nearby attractions include the Easley Winery, the Circle Centre Mall, the Indianapolis City Market, and Bankers Life Fieldhouse.
